This week Nike made nerd-dreams come true, finally making a movie icon available to the purchasing public. These long-awaited shoes are replicas of those worn by Fox’s character Marty McFly in the 1985 film Back to the Future (not sure why I feel the need to give you character and movie details — if you don’t know it, see pie chart below*).

For a limited time, the shoes are available on eBay with auction proceeds benefitting The Michael J. Fox Foundation for Parkinson Research. While the current model doesn’t feature the originals’ self-lacing technology, rumors have it that Nike might still have another surprise down the road.
